About Color #DED6DB (#DED6DB)
#DED6DB is a pink color (colour) with RGB channel values of 222 red, 214 green, and 219 blue. The red channel is dominant with a relatively balanced channel distribution. In HSL terms, the hue sits at 323 degrees with 11% saturation and 85% lightness, placing it in the warm range of the colour spectrum.
The perceived brightness of #DED6DB is 217/255 using the ITU-R BT.601 luma formula (0.299R + 0.587G + 0.114B). This means it appears bright to the human eye and is best paired with dark text for readability. For print production, the CMYK equivalent is 0% cyan, 4% magenta, 1% yellow, and 13% key (black).
The WCAG contrast ratio of #DED6DB against white is 1.42:1 and against black is 14.75:1. This does not meet AA requirements on white. Use it on dark backgrounds where it achieves 14.75:1, or use it exclusively for decorative purposes.
The complementary colour #D5DDD8 creates maximum visual tension when paired with #DED6DB. For more harmonious color combinations, use the analogous colours #DCD5DD and #DDD5D6, which sit 30 degrees on either side of the hue wheel. To build a complete design system, start with the monochromatic scale above for consistent shade variations, then add one complementary or triadic accent for interactive elements.

What is HEX to RGB, HSL, CMYK color conversion
Converting from HEX to RGB, HSL, CMYK translates a color value between two different color models. Different color models are used in web design (HEX, RGB), print (CMYK), and color theory (HSL, HSV).
